Question need help with pc case

i just got the coolermaster cosmos case last night and when i was trying to hook the Power LED cable to my MOBO the cable on my case the cable only has 2 pin holes and on my mobo the pins are spaced out to far so the cable dont fit on my mobo i have the asus P5B MOBO.... has anyone run into something like this and how do you get around it to fix it?

If you can find a 3 pin connector you can swap the pins from the 2 pin connector to the 3 pin. The pin connectors come out of the plastic housing by lifting a little flap on the back.
